Purchasing a new home can cost, on average, more than $450,000—a high price tag for most Canadians. Because of this, many individuals are opting to rent long term, which often requires them to purchase renters insurance in order to protect their belongings. But, many people are under the impression that renters insurance isn’t really necessary. The three myths listed below are some of the most common misconceptions individuals have regarding the necessity of renters insurance.
Myth 1: Renters insurance only covers personal belongings.
When fire or water damage occurs in one rental property, it can impact nearby units. Renters insurance protects the individuals in the other units from taking on any costs. In addition, renters insurance typically offers liability protection to cover medical or legal expenses associated with accidents that occur on a property.
Myth 2: Renters insurance is expensive.
The cost of renters insurance can vary, but most individuals will pay less than $20 a month for complete coverage. This is cheaper than most other types of insurance.
Myth 3: Renters insurance is only for those with many valuables.
Often, people underestimate the cost of replacing personal items that are lost due to theft, fire, etc. Experts say that a renter living in a two-bedroom apartment could have an average of $40,000 worth of belongings.
